Designing for the future 🏡 JJHS environmental physics students took passive house design from concept to full build, mapping out blueprints, airflow, insulation, and energy systems with real-world purpose. Designs also incorporated accessibility features like ramps, wide doorways, and no-step layouts. High school students presented their projects to 4th graders at Increase Miller and Katonah Elementary, helping connect younger students to sustainability topics through peer-led learning.

Exciting sustainability achievement 🌎 We are thrilled to announce that KLSD has received the New York State Green Ribbon Schools award! From solar power to cleaner transportation to a geothermal energy system, our efforts are making a big impact. Students are leading the way by advocating for climate policy, getting their hands dirty in the garden, and working with local conservation organizations.

Another Successful Sustainability Showcase 🌱🌎

On Tuesday evening, the district celebrated its sustainability progress and goals with student projects, examples of energy savings across the district, and even a tour on board one of the district’s electric buses.

Elementary school Green Teams showed off their efforts and older students shared research projects. These initiatives focused on recycling and waste reduction, protecting wildlife and habitats, and the impact of everyday choices on the environment, along with ecosystem models and builds created from reused materials. Our community partners joined the conversation with displays and a Q&A panel, highlighting conservation efforts, wildlife education, and sustainable practices.
